A Java Runtime Environment error usually occurs when the Java driver installed on the computer is either unsupported by MATLAB or in a corrupted state. MATLAB only supports the version of Java specified in this link: https://www.mathworks.com/support/requirements/language-interfaces.html.
To check the current Java version in MATLAB, type the following command in the MATLAB Command Window:
version -java
If the output is not as expected, reinstalling Java might be the right choice. You can download the correct version from Oracle's website.
